MK50DX256CMD10 Frequently Asked Questions (FAQs)

  • The recommended operating voltage range for the MK50DX256CMD10 is 2.7V to 3.6V, with a typical voltage of 3.3V.
  • The MK50DX256CMD10 uses a proprietary flash programming algorithm. NXP provides a Flash Tool and a Command Line Tool for programming and erasing the flash memory. It's recommended to follow the guidelines and examples provided in the NXP documentation and application notes.
  • The MK50DX256CMD10 can operate up to a maximum clock frequency of 100 MHz, but it's recommended to consult the datasheet and application notes for specific clock frequency limitations and considerations.
  • The MK50DX256CMD10 has several low-power modes, including Stop, VLPR, and VLPW. To implement power management, refer to the datasheet and application notes for guidance on configuring the Power Management Controller (PMC) and using the Low Power Mode (LPM) module.
  • When designing a PCB with the MK50DX256CMD10, it's essential to follow the recommended layout guidelines in the datasheet and application notes, including signal integrity, decoupling, and thermal considerations.

About NXP

NXP Semiconductors is a leading manufacturer of semiconductor devices with a wide range of semiconductor solutions, including microcontrollers, sensors, connectivity solutions, power management ICs, and security solutions. These products are used in a variety of applications such as automotive, industrial automation, smart homes, mobile devices, and more. NXP Semiconductors is one of the world’s largest semiconductor companies and is headquartered in Eindhoven, the Netherlands.
